11. Change The Way You Brush

If you brush your teeth vigorously, it is easy for your teeth to get sensitivity. The possible reason may be that hard brushing will damage or wear away the enamel. If you are suffering from the teeth sensitivity, it will make your condition gets worse. Moreover, hard brushing will erode the gums or make bone loss. As a result, the tooth root is exposed. You can also scrub at cementum. Cementum is the root protector; however it can wear down faster than enamel. Therefore, it is needed to change if you want to know the home remedies for sensitive teeth. According to Bowerman, changing the way your brush your teeth is the big step to reverse teeth sensitivity.

12. Warm Salt Water

If you suffer from teeth sensitivity, a glass of warm salt water will give you the significant relief. All you need to do are dissolving one teaspoon of salt into a glass of warm water and rinsing your mouth thoroughly. This remedy will help you to fight against the bacteria causing teeth sensitivity.

13. Cloves

Thanks to antibacterial, anti-inflammatory, anesthetic and antioxidant, it makes the cloves become one of the effective home remedies for sensitive teeth at home. Eugenol which is a component of cloves can do this great job. It is no wonder when Eugonol is utilized in the form of a mixture or paste as filler, dental cement, and restorative material. Clove oil is often used as an anesthetic and old remedy for most of the tooth problem, including toothache and sensitivity. In Germany, there are many clinical trials that prove the effectiveness of cloves.

If you experience a toothache or teeth sensitivity, why do not you try clove remedy before going to the dentist?

  • The simplest way is holding the whole cloves in your sensitive tooth until it is chewed up. After that, you can spit it out.
  • The alternative option is using the cotton ball in the mixture of olive oil and clove oil and then applying it on your affected tooth. Hold it for a few minutes until the pain and discomfort vanish.
  • Moreover, you can mix a few drops of clove oil in a glass of warm water and use it as the mouth rinse in order to relieve from teeth sensitivity. If you want to have the good result, you should apply this treatment for a couple of weeks.

15. Onion

It is said that onion is effective as the brushing agent to ease your teeth sensitivity. The possible reason may be that onion has antimicrobial and antiseptic properties that can control the pain and alleviate the discomfort caused by teeth sensitivity. Therefore, when you experience the teeth sensitivity, you can hold a raw onion in your mouth and try to chew it to alleviate the pain. If you do not want to chew, you can apply onion juice on your affected teeth and hole it for a few minutes until you get the relief.
